Correction bonus IUT Tours

This commit is contained in:
Emmanuel Viennet 2022-01-26 18:35:42 +01:00
parent 8081df686b
commit 536ee1781b
2 changed files with 11 additions and 7 deletions

View File

@ -276,15 +276,17 @@ class BonusColmar(BonusSportSimples):
class BonusTours(BonusSportSimples):
"""Calcul bonus sport & culture IUT Tours.
Les notes des UE bonus sont sommées et ajoutées aux moyennes: soit à la
moyenne générale, soit pour le BUT à chaque moyenne d'UE.
Le bonus est limité à 1 point.
Les notes des UE bonus (ramenées sur 20) sont sommées
et 1/40 (2,5%) est ajouté aux moyennes: soit à la moyenne générale,
soit pour le BUT à chaque moyenne d'UE.
Le bonus total est limité à 1 point.
"""
name = "bonus_tours"
bonus_moy_gen_limit = 1.0
bonus_moy_gen_limit = 1.0 #
seuil_moy_gen = 0.0 # seuls les points au dessus du seuil sont comptés
proportion_point = 1.0
proportion_point = 1.0 / 40.0
# ---- Un peu moins simples (mais pas trop compliqué)

View File

@ -28,10 +28,12 @@
from operator import mul
import pprint
"""
""" ANCIENS BONUS SPORT pour ScoDoc < 9.2 NON UTILISES A PARTIR DE 9.2 (voir comp/bonus_spo.py)
La fonction bonus_sport reçoit:
- notes_sport: la liste des notes des modules de sport et culture (une note par module de l'UE de type sport/culture);
- notes_sport: la liste des notes des modules de sport et culture (une note par module
de l'UE de type sport/culture, toujours dans remise sur 20);
- coefs: un coef (float) pondérant chaque note (la plupart des bonus les ignorent);
- infos: dictionnaire avec des données pouvant être utilisées pour les calculs.
Ces données dépendent du type de formation.